Ensure the activation code matches the exact version of the software installed. A license key for Network Inventory Advisor version 4.x will generally not activate version 5.x unless you have an active maintenance and upgrade subscription. network inventory advisor activation code work

Sometimes, briefly. You might enter a code and see “Activation Successful” locally. However, the software phones home periodically. Within days or weeks, the license will be flagged as invalid, and the software will revert to trial mode—or stop working entirely. In some cases, the software may even disable scanning functions or display persistent nags.
